Well ladies and germs..... The project is not dead! Long story short, the body guy and I had a little falling out during this build. Truck sat at the shop for 2 1/2 years me hearing every few weeks "2 more cars and we'll get back on your truck". We made no more progress than the last pics you see. Ended up just taking the truck and all my parts home late 2012. Put it and all the parts in the garage because I was so pissed at the whole situation I had to walk away from it for a while.
I ended up buying a truck off of Beastmode that was floating around all the truck sites for a while around that time (fall 2012?) It was about 6 different colors. I went from Fastcount 03, to trilogy28 or something like that to beastmode to me. I borrowed some parts off the Escalade truck and slapped her together (not being worried about body work for a while and left it all multicolored!) for LS fest 2012 and entered truckin throwdown. Ended up Killing in drag race portion (best ET, Trap speed and reaction time) and getting a mini feature in truckin mag!

So..... the question is, what am I going to do with the escarado?
Got a few options:
#1
Caddy clip is looking a little dated and want to get away from the escalade look and more toward the V series caddy look. Truck is going back to 243 headed lq9 zo6 cam basic build (I used all the go fast parts in the orange truck).
Truck would be all black. Thinking of tinting headlights make them look a little smaller, all mesh black grille, just a crest on the grille and gate, 1 "V" emblem in bottom corner of gate and one on each door where the 1500 emblem normally goes. switch truck to 5 lug, They make matte black CTS-V Replica wheels in 20x9 and 20x11 or something close to that and CTS-V 6 piston front and 4 piston rear calipers. If I can find a set of CTS-V recaros that someone doesn't want a mint for that would be nice, and dye the whole interior black. I have many parts and little details for this to work well being it was very close to my original plan anyway, and still have my vanity plate that I ordered (HY CLASS)<-- love it or hate it lol
#2
Esky look may be starting to really be dated, Do 06 silvy ss front and red jewel tintcoat paint. basic look ss 20's, Z06 brakes. Would look great imo, but I already have one. And with the ss look you don't really stand out anymore.
Im just at a crossroads with this project. They say your first choice is usually the correct or best one, and to my knowledge no one has built a "CTS-V" Truck concept. I want to finish it just want to take the right path after it being apart for over 5 years
